1972 XLCH 1000 Is a Champion R12YC correct ??? H8C !!! The dude at the auto parts store sold me a RN12YC Now trying to find out the differences to see if it hurt anything running that plug... The plug looks rich... black & sooty... So at least it wasn't running way too hot or lean..
Update: The Champion H8C plug is now called a 587 and the NGK cross reference is a BL6

Jumbo, I followed those charts and they aren't that helpful!!! I'm member of the QCB Forum and got some good advice from Crazyhorse Speed Shop"s Frank. The dude is a master at rebuilding heads and porting! I have a 1957 Ironhead and I just changed the plug wires and the plugs. I was running the Champion H8C, fouled those fuckers all the time and it was hard to start that old bastard. I was told by frank and forum member Papa, that I should be using the Autolite 85 or J12Y with points or RJ12Y with electronic ignition. I put in the Autolites and, Man, what a difference. Two kicks and it started! Used to take about 8-10 kicks with the champions. Runs smoother and doesn't seem to miss in the high RPM range.
